Double wide demolition services involve the complete removal of large, multi-section structures, such as double-wide manufactured homes or expansive modular buildings. This process includes carefully dismantling the structure, safely handling debris, and clearing the site for future use.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to ensure the demolition is efficient and complies with local regulations, making it easier for property owners to prepare a site for new construction, renovations, or redevelopment projects.

This service helps address a variety of property problems, including extensive structural damage, outdated or obsolete mobile homes, or the need to clear space for new construction. Homeowners who have purchased a property with an aging or non-functional double-wide may find demolition necessary to remove the existing structure before building a new residence or expanding their property. Additionally, property owners planning to convert land for commercial use or develop new housing subdivisions often rely on these services to clear large structures efficiently.

Typically, properties that utilize double wide demolition services include mobile home parks, rural residential lots, and properties undergoing major renovations. These structures are often too large for simple teardown methods, requiring specialized equipment and expertise to dismantle safely. The overview below groups typical Double Wide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Richland,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small Demolition Projects - Local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600 for routine demolition jobs like removing sheds or small garages. Many projects fall within this middle range, depending on site conditions and material types. Larger or more complex jobs may exceed this range.

Medium-Scale Demolition - For moderate projects such as partial building removals or interior demolitions, costs generally range from $1,000 to $3,000. These jobs are common and usually involve more extensive planning and equipment use, but rarely reach the highest tiers.

Large Demolition Tasks - Demolishing entire structures like large commercial buildings or multi-story homes can cost between $5,000 and $15,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ent and require specialized equipment and permits, which can influence the final price.

Full Building Demolition - Complete teardown of a large property or industrial site can range from $20,000 to $100,000+, depending on size, complexity, and location. These are specialized jobs that often involve extensive planning, making costs vary widely based on project specifics.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of structures can Double Wide Demolition services handle? Local contractors can safely demolish a variety of structures, including mobile homes, large trailers, and similar wide-format buildings.

Are permits required for Double Wide Demolition projects in Richland, WA? Typically, local regulations may require permits, and service providers can assist with obtaining the necessary approvals for demolition work.

What safety measures do local contractors follow during demolition? Demolition professionals adhere to safety protocols to manage debris and ensure the site is secure throughout the project.

Can Double Wide Demolition services remove all debris and materials? Yes, most local service providers handle debris removal and site cleanup as part of their demolition process.

How do local contractors prepare for a Double Wide Demolition project? Preparation involves assessing the structure, disconnecting utilities, and planning the safest approach for the demolition process.
